From this Friday, visitors to the Art Gallery of NSW will be able to take in masterpieces by Monet, Manet, and now Moran, following the launch of a new gallery restaurant.

Called Art Gallery Restaurant Crafted by Matt Moran, the new Mediterranean diner will take over from Moran’s previous offering, Chiswick at the Gallery.

True to the Moran style, the restaurant will showcase locally-sourced produce and the best in Australian meat and seafood.

The restaurant will open during the day with a menu of light, seasonal Mediterranean-style dishes.  The brunch menu will include buttermilk lemon scones and crab sliders, alongside tea and Single O coffee and sparkling wine. For lunch, there’s antipasti such as Alto olive oil focaccia paired with taramasalata as well as beef carpaccio with radicchio and parmesan, grilled swordfish with sautéed Italian greens and blueberry and almond crostata with lemon mascarpone for dessert.

The drinks menu has been curated by Samantha Payne and features an all-Australian wine list, as well as Champagne, cocktails, beers, ciders and a substantial non-alcoholic offering.

“The Art Gallery of NSW holds a special place in my heart, having worked with the venue for the last seven years,” Matt Moran said.  “It’s an incredible venue, and grazing your way through our brunch, lunch or afternoon tea menu, while inside one of Sydney’s cultural hubs is unbeatable in my opinion – there’s no better day out. In fact, many of the dishes have been inspired by the unique space itself.”

Matt Moran has also been appointed culinary advisor for the gallery, which means he will also oversee the venue’s food, beverage and catering program.
